Inscribed to the Earl of Roscommon, on his intended

Voyage to Ireland.

O may th' auspicious queen of love,

So may th

And the twin stars the feed of Jove,

And he who rules the raging wind,
To thee, O facred ship, be kind;
And gentle breezes fill thy fails,
Supplying foft Etesian gales :

As thou, to whom the Muse commends
The best of poets and of friends,

Doft thy committed pledge restore,
And land him fafely on the shore;
And fave the better part of me,

From perishing with him at sea,
Sure he, who first the passage try'd,
In harden'd oak his heart did hide,
And ribs of iron arm'd his fide;
Or his at least, in hollow wood

Who tempted first the briny flood:
Nor fear'd the winds contending roar,
Nor billows beating on the shore;
Nor Hyades portending rain;
Nor all the tyrants of the main.
What form of death could him affright,
Who unconcern'd, with stedfast fight,
Could view the furges mounting steep,
And monfters rolling in the deep!
Could thro the ranks of ruin go,
With ftorms above, and rocks below!
In vain did Nature's wife command
Divide the waters from the land,
If daring ships and men prophane
Invade th' inviolable main;
Th' eternal fences over-leap,
And pass at will the boundless deep.

No toil, no hardship can reftrain
Ambitious man inur'd to pain;

The more confin'd, the more he tries,

And at forbidden quarry flies.

Thus bold Prometheus did aspire,

And stole from Heav'n the feeds of fire:

A train of ills, a ghastly crew,
The robber's blazing track pursue;
Fierce famine with her meagre face,
And fevers of the fiery race,
In swarms th' offending wretch furround,
All brooding on the blasted ground:
And limping death, lash'd on by fate,
Comes up to shorten half our date.
This made not Dedalus beware,
With borrow'd wings to fail in air :
To hell Alcides forc'd his way,
Plung'd thro the lake, and snatch'd the prey.
Nay scarce the Gods, or heavenly climes,
Are fafe from our audacious crimes;
We reach at Jove's imperial crown.
And pull th' unwilling thunder down.
